首先使用MyCat登录需要一个前提,那就是有MySQL的主从复制

开始搭建MySQL主从复制(一主一从)

一、配置文件修改

  • 主机配置文件修改
server-id=1 # 定义服务器唯一ID
log-bin=mysql-bin # 启用二进制日志
binlog-ignore-db=mysql # 忽略 mysql 库(如果配置了binlog-do-db的话可以不需要设置这个)
binlog-do-db=testdb # 设置需要主从复制的库
binlog_format=STATEMENT
  • 从机配置文件修改
server-id=2 #从服务器唯一ID
relay-log=mysql-relay #启用中继日志
replicate-do-db=testdb # 设置需要同步的数据库

二、分别登录主机和从机进行操作

  • 主机上建立一个从库复制的授权用户
create user '用户名'@'授权的IP' identified by '用户的密码'; # 创建用户
grant replication slave on *.* to '用户名'@'授权的IP'; # 授权,这里为了方便,授予全部权限
flush privileges; # 刷新权限
  • show master status; 查看主机 master 的状态
  • 记录下 mysql-bin.000003 和 3386 的值

三、设置从机

# 如果之前有设置过主从复制,需要使用 stop slave; 命令来关闭主从复制的功能,重新设置
change master to master_host='授权主机IP',master_port=主机端口,master_user='创建的用户名',master_password='创建用户的密码',master_log_file='mysql-bin.000003',master_log_pos=3386,get_master_public_key=1; # 设置从机的需要复制的主机信息

四、启动主从复制

start slave; # 开启主从复制功能
show slave status\G; # 查看主从复制状态
# 如果 IO 和 SQL 的值都为 running 则配置成功;

如果MySQL是8.0以上的用户注意了,因为新版的MySQL的密码认证器改了,传统的MyCat的授权认证方式登录不进去,一直会报 Access denied for user ‘mycat’, because password is error 错误,具体原因 查看 这里

MyCat学习:使用MySQL搭建主从复制(一主一从模式)相关推荐

  1. MyCat学习:使用MySQL搭建主从复制(双主双从模式)

    首先,上一篇我们建立了一主一丛模式的MySQL读写分离 点击这里 那么接下来,我们搭建双主双从模式的读写分离,并且使用MyCat登录访问 原理:master1,master2,slave1,slave ...

  2. MySQL搭建主从复制 读写分离 分库分表 MyCat高可用

    主从演示 读写演示 分表演示 主从复制 环境的介绍 系统环境:centos7.0 客户端连接工具:xshell 远程文件传输工具:xftp 服务器: 192.168.126.138(主) 192.16 ...

  3. MySQL搭建主从复制架构实战

    主从复制原理 主库配置文件my.conf 在主库创建同步用户 从库配置文件my.conf 搭建主库 解决docker MySQL容器group by报错问题: vi my.cnf 搭建从库 主从复制模 ...

  4. mysql数据库主从复制步骤_MySQL搭建主从复制详细步骤

    MySQL搭建主从复制详细步骤 发布时间:2020-05-26 11:23:27 来源:51CTO 阅读:122 作者:三月 下面讲讲关于MySQL搭建主从复制详细步骤,文字的奥妙在于贴近主题相关.所 ...

  5. MyCAT+MySQL 搭建高可用企业级数据库集群

    第1章 课程介绍 课程介绍 1-1 MyCAT导学 试看 1-2 课程介绍 第2章 MyCAT入门 这一章中,我们将回顾了垂直切分,水平切分,分库分表等基础概念,然后快速回如何安装和启动MyCAT的, ...

  6. MySQL主从复制(一主一从)部署

    文章目录 MySQL主从复制 1.MySQL主从复制概述 1.1 MySQL主从复制原理 1.2 MySQL主从复制的好处 1.3 MySQL主从复制的形式 2.主从复制配置 2.1主从复制配置步骤 ...

  7. mysql gtid 搭建主从_MySQL5.7 - 基于GTID复制模式搭建主从复制

    MySQL5.7 - 基于GTID复制模式搭建主从复制 发布时间:2020-04-17 10:09:20 来源:51CTO 阅读:226 作者:insist_way 环境: MySQL5.7.24版本 ...

  8. 基于mysql的主从复制之Mycat简单配置和高可用

    what-mycat 1.Mycat就是MySQL Server,而Mycat后面连接的MySQL Server,就好象是MySQL的存储引擎,如InnoDB,MyISAM等. 因此,Mycat本身并 ...

  9. 一篇搞懂MySQL 8.0 Clone技术在线搭建主从复制全过程

    墨墨导读:MySQL从8.0.17开始新增了克隆Clone技术,可以在线进行MySQL的本地克隆或远程克隆,从此搭建从库可以不再需要备份工具来实现了,本文分享Clone技术在线搭建主从复制全过程,希望 ...

最新文章

  1. Vivado中如何避免信号被优化掉?
  2. openstack(Queens) neutron-l3-agent 代码解析1(从命令行启动到同步plugin数据)
  3. 【深度学习】CornerNet: 将目标检测问题视作关键点检测与配对
  4. html5图片自动翻转特效,CSS3带动态阴影效果的3D图片翻转特效
  5. python爬虫之基于scrapy_redis的分布式爬虫
  6. 从头到脚说单测——谈有效的单元测试
  7. NetBeans 时事通讯(刊号 # 134 - Jan 25, 2011)
  8. 近距离无线通信技术对比
  9. access字体变为斜体_Linux折腾记(四):Linux桌面系统字体配置详解
  10. 中兴获25个5G商用合同
  11. 关于中国男女的一些私密数据......
  12. GDB使用gdb-stl-views打印STL容器元素
  13. MSP430常见问题之开发工具类
  14. 计算机论文摘要200字模板,设计论文摘要万能模板_论文摘要万能模板_论文摘要200字模板...
  15. java处理环比增长率
  16. 基于SSH的实验室设备管理系统mysql
  17. 关于nvidia-smi和nvidia -V即nvidia --verison的命令说明
  18. Win7蓝屏代码 0x0000007B
  19. 烟雨黑帽seo超级模板站群-可一键清除内页URL转换成单页-百度搜狗超级模板站群-多城市网站站群
  20. C语言的逻辑右移和算术右移

热门文章

  1. SAP日志log:SLG0,SLG1
  2. IAAS、SAAS、PAAS
  3. IT人员健康信号之颈椎病自疗
  4. 数据库优化之统计分析实战篇
  5. SD--关于价格过程的确定
  6. 如何通过 BAPI 更新 PO 采购订单中的 confirmation tab 中的 confirmation date.
  7. 万亿市场下,电商代运营还需另求“第二曲线”
  8. python mulit函数_python – 将函数应用于MultiIndex pandas.DataFrame列
  9. redis 依赖_springboot|springboot集成redis缓存
  10. 用python读取股票价格_使用Python写一个量化股票提醒系统